Great value for the price. We stayed here July 10-11 2015. Our room was 122 right by the pool. Upon entering the room (smoking) it was clean and fresh and well stocked with coffees and a tea, coffeemaker, microwave and micro-fridge. Dated, but nice. An old-school room at old-school prices. The pool was very clean and well-maintained. Several cable channels but nothing premium. There is a Japanese restaurant on site that we did not try. Continental breakfast is things like instant grits, instant oatmeal, yogurt, breads, juice, milk and coffee. We went up front for coffee late but were cheerfully given some extra coffee packets for our room. There is a nice area behind the pool with picnic tables and a grill. We plan to visit again soon. Near Kerr Scott state park and Sagebrush steakhouse and BK and Wendy's right across the road. Many families were staying there at the same time. Highly recommend if you are on a budget and want a decent overnight somewhere without breaking the bank. Under $70 for a night.
